There are several factors to keep in mind while choosing composite facade panels. Much like packing for a vacation, where you consider the destination, weather, and activities, selecting the right panels involves assessing your project’s unique requirements.- Purpose of the Building: Is it a commercial space, a residential home, or an industrial building?- Climate Considerations: Will your structure face harsh weather conditions like heavy rains or extreme temperatures?- Design Aesthetics: What type of look are you aiming for—sleek modern or rustic charm?- Budget Limitations: Determine a clear budget to understand which panels fall within your financial scope.- Installation Requirements: Consider if your team has the skills to install the panels or if youll need to hire professionals.- Long-Term Goals: Are you planning for future expansion or modifications?- Maintenance Needs: How much time and resources can you commit to upkeep? Analyzing these factors will set you on the right path to making a choice that fits perfectly with your vision and project requirements.2. Quality Indicators: What Makes a Good Composite Panel?
Not all composite facade panels are created equal! Here are key indicators of quality to look for when shopping around:- Thickness: Panels that are at least 4mm thick tend to provide better durability and insulation.- Core Material: Look for high-density polyethylene or mineral cores for enhanced fire resistance and structural integrity. - Finish Options: Quality panels should offer UV-resistant finishes that help retain color over time.- Warranty: A good warranty is a reflection of a manufacturer’s confidence in their product quality—look for warranties of 10 years or longer.- Certifications: Ensure that the panels meet industry standards like ASTM or ISO for safety and performance.Paying attention to these details can make a significant difference in your overall satisfaction with the panels.3. The first critical aspect to assess is the initial purchase price of the panels. The average cost of composite facade panels generally ranges between 50 EUR to 100 EUR per square meter. This variability is influenced by several factors including:- Material Composition: Different materials will affect the price. Aluminum composite panels usually cost less than high-density polyethylene variants. - Thickness: Panels thicker than 4mm provide better insulation and durability but may come at a higher price point.- Finishing Options: Special finishes, like anti-fading or custom colors, can raise costs further. So, you need to ask yourself: what’s your design vision? A stunning, customized finish might look fantastic but could also stretch your budget.2. Installation Expenses: Factoring in Labor Costs
The price of panels is only part of the equation; installation adds another layer of expense. Depending on the complexity of your project and local labor rates, installation can range from 40 EUR to 90 EUR per square meter. Here are elements influencing these costs:- Installation Skill Level: Hiring experienced professionals can incur higher upfront costs but may save you money in the long run by ensuring quality installation.- Time Frame: Tight timelines may require more labor, thus inflating overall costs.- Structural Modifications: If your building requires additional structural work to accommodate the panels, this can add significant expense.To illustrate, consider a commercial project in Amsterdam where the combination of intricate design and tight deadlines pushed the total installation cost to 150 EUR per square meter, essentially doubling the initial material cost.
